Устройство для ввода информации в вычислительную машину

 

:. i VC3; Е.

ИЗОБРЕТЕНИЯ

Союз Советскии

Социалистических

Республик оо696437

К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 (61) Дополнительное к авт. свид-ву(22) Заявлеио 230277 (21) 2455626/18-24 с присоединением заявки М (23) Приоритет (51)М. Кл.2

G 06 Г 3/04

Государственный комитет

СССР по делам изобретений и открытий (53) УДК 881.14 (088.8) Опубликовано 051179. Бюллетень Йо 41

Дата опубликования описания

В. М. Златников, Б. Л. Золотаревский, IO. В, Кутынин, С. Я. Никитин, Г. К. Петрова и A. A. Суханов (72) Авторы изобретения (71) Заявитель (54) УСТРОЙСТВО ДЛЯ ВВОДА ИНФОРМАЦИИ

В ВЫЧИСЛИТЕУЪ НУЮ МАШИНУ

Устройство для ввода информации в вычислительную машину относится к области вычислительной техники и предназначено для использования в устройствах обмена вычислительных систем обработки информации пузырьковых камер.

Известно устройство для ввода информации, используемое в системе о6работки информации с помощью ЦВМ (1).

Это устройство не производит анализа вводимой информации, а выполняет лишь функции буферизации данных при переда1 че в ЦВМ.

Наиболее близким техническим решением к данному является входной регистр,регистр команды и блок управления,первый вход которого соединен со вторым входом входного регистра, второй выход соединен с первым входом регистра команды, первый выход регистра команды соединен со входом блока управления,выход РегистРа команды сое- 25 динен с запоминающим устройством ЦВМ, второй вход регистра команды соединен с устройством управления ЦВМ,первый вход входного регистра подключен к . источнику информации, а на второй вход блока управления поступает тактовая частота (2) .

При заполнении входного регистра информацией, она передается в з апоминающее устройство ЦВМ по адресу, указанному в регистре команды. При приеме информации иэ устройства сканирования фотопленки с результатами физического эксперимента необходимо знать для каждой линии сканирования значение суммарного рассогласования скорости движения механической платформы с фотопленкой относительно скорости. вращения диска, обеспечивающе го формирование луча развертки для считывания инфбрмации с фотопленки, При этом величины кода рассогласования могут иметь положительное или отрицательное значение, Вычисление суммарного кода рассогласования производится программно в ЦВМ и требует значительного машинного времени, а для хранения всего массива кодов рассогласования требуется расходовать значительный объем памяти ЦВМ .

Целью настоящего изобретения является расширение функциональных возможностей устройства эа счет формирования суммарного кода рассогласования

696437 для каждой линии сканирования, производимого до передачи в вычислительнуюмашину.

Это достигается тем, что в устройство для ввода информации в вычислительную машину введены буферный регистр, блок управления сумматором и выходной регистр, первый вход которого соединен с четвертым выходом блока управления; второй вход — с первым выходом блока управления сумматором, третий вход — с выходом реверс ив ного счетчика и первым в ходом блока управления сумматором, четвертый вход — c первым выходом буферного регистра и вторым входом сумматора, вто-15 рой выход входного регистра йодключен ко второму входу блока управления сум- матором, третий вход которого соединен ! с пятым выходом блока управления, четвертый вход — со вторым выходом буферного регистра, первый вход которого

20 подключен к первому выходу сумматора, второй вход — к шестому выходу блока управления, второй вход реверсивного счетчика соединен со вторым выходом блока управления сумматором, выход выходного регистра является вторым выходом устройства.

На чертеже представлена блок-схема изобретения. 30

Устройство для ввода информации в вычислительную машину содержит регистр

1 команды со входами 2, 3 и выходами

4, 5, блок 6 управления со входами

7, 8 и выходами 9, 10, 11, 12, 13, 14,З5 входной регистр 15 со входами 16, 17 и выходами 18, 19, сумматор 20 со входами 21, 22 и выходами 23, 24, буферный регистр 25 со входами 26, 27 и выходами 28, 29, блок 30 управления сумматором со входами 31, 32, 33, 34, 35 и выходами 36, 37, реверсивный счетчик 38 со входами 39, 40 и выходом 41, выходной регистр 42 со входами 43, 44, 45, 46 и выходом

47. 45

Устройство работает следующим образом.

В процессе выполнения команды, информация иэ устройства сканирования фотопленки принимается во входной 50 регистр. Разрядность входной информа ции меньше разрядности суммарной величины выдаваемой в ЦВМ. Поэтому при формировании результирующего кода выполняется сложение текущего кода 55 из входного регистра и младших разрядов накопленного результата в сумматоре, а формирование старших разрядов результата происходит в реверсивном счетчике. По окончании операции слажения младшие разряды накопленно- го результата передаются в буферный регистр, а к числу, находящемуся в реверсивном счетчике, добавляется единица или вычитается из него единица, в зависимости от знаков и величины складываемых чисел. Информация из буферного регистра и реверсивного счетчика, а также знак числа из блока управления сумматором передаются в выходной регистр. Из выходного регистра информация поступает в память ЦВМ по адресу, указанному в регистре команды. Количество цвоичных разрядов в буферном регистре такое же как и во входном регистре. В сумматоре обрабатываются абсолютные значения величин., Количество разрядов реверсивного счетчика выбирается таким, чтобы можно было сформировать код максимального суммарного числа.

Код команды поступает из ЦВМ на вход 2 регистра команды 1. При по( ступлении на вход 3 регистра 1 сигнала разрешения приема с выхода 9 блока 6 код команды принимается в регистр 1 и с выхода 4 поступает на вход 7 блока 6. В коде команды указывается режим работы устройства.При поступлении тактового сигнала на вход

8 блока 6 формируется сигнал разрешения приема информации на выходе 10, поступающий на вход 16 входного регистра 15 для приема информации со входа 17 регистра 15. С выхода 18 регистра 15 код числа поступает на вход сумматора 20. На вход 22 суммато-, ра 20 поступает код накопленного результата с выхода 28 буферного регистра 25, С выхода 19 регистра 15 знак числа поступает на вход 31 блока 30, с выхода регистра 25 на вход

32 блока 30 поступает знак накопленного результата. В сумматоре 20 происходит сложение кодов. При переполнении вырабатывается Сигнал на выходе 23 сумматора 20, поступающий на вход 33 блока 30, Энак результата поступает (" выхода 36 блока 30 на вход 43 выходного регистра 42. При этом знак формируется следующим образ ом: ( сли знаки исходных кодов одинаковые, то в знак результата поступает знак кода буферного регистра; — если знаки исходных кодов разные и число, записанное в счетчике 38 не равно нулю, то в знак результата поступает знак кода буферного регистра; — если знаки исходных кодов разные и число, записанное в реверсивном . счетчике 38, равно нулю, и возникает сигнал переполнения в сумматоре, то в знак результата поступает знак кода буферного регистра;

- если знаки исходных кодов разные и число, записанное в реверсивном счетчике 38, равно нулю, и нет сигнала переполнения в сумматоре, то в знак результата поступает знак кода входного регистра;

696437

Таким образом, данное устройство производит обработку входной инФормации путем вычисления величины суммарного рассогласования скорости движения механической платформы с фотопленкой относительно скорости вращения диска, обеспечивающего формирование.луча -развертки для считывания информации с фотопленки . Применение даНного изобретения в вычислительных системах позволит уменьшить объем памяти, занимаемый массивом входной информации, а также уменьшить время, затрачиваемое процессо» ром на обработку входной информации .

На выходе 37 блока 30 формируется сигнал добавления или вычитания единицы, поступающий на вход 39 счетчика 38.

Условие добавления и вычитания единицы следующее: 5 если знаки исходных кодов одинаковые и в сумматоре возникает сигнал

-переполнения, то к коду числаг находящемуся в счетчике 38 добавляется единица; — если знаки исходных кодов разные, и число в реверсивном счетчике не равно нулю, и нет сигнала переполнения в сумматоре, то иэ кода числа, находящегося в реверсивном счетчике, вычитается единица..

Иа вход 40 счетчика 38 поступают сигналы управления счетом с выхода

11 блока 6, на выходе 24 сумматора

20 формируется код суммы, который поступает на вход регистра 25. При поступлении сигнала разрешения приеа с выхода 12 блока 6 на вход 27 егистра 25 код суммы принимается в регистр 25..С выхода 28 регистра 25 младшие разряды накопленной суммы поступают на вход 44 регистра 42.

da вход 45 регистра 42 поступают старшие разряды. накопленной суммы с выхода 41 реверсивного счетчика 38.

Выход 41 реверсивного счетчика 38 соединен со входом 34 блока 30. Иа, вход 35 блока 30 поступают снгналы синхронизации с выхода блока 6. При поступлении сигнала разрешения приема на вход 46 регистра 42 ° с выхода g$ . 14 блока 6 информация со входов 43, 44, 45 принимается в регистр 42. Информация с выхода 47 выходного регистра 42 поступает в память ЦВМ по адресу, передаваемому по шинам 5 ре- 4П гистра команды 1.

Формула изобретения

Устройство для ввода информации в вычислительную машину, содержащее сумматор, реверсивный счетчик, входной регистр, первый вход которого . является информационным входом устройства, регистр команды и блок управления, первый выход которого соединен со вторым входом входного регистра, второй выход — с первым входом регистра команды, первый выход которого подключен к первому входу блока управления, второй вход яВляется управляющим входом устройства, а второй выход — первым выходом устройства, первый вход сумматора соединен с первым выходом входного регистра, третий выход блока управления подключен к первому входу реверсивного счетчика, о т л и ч а ю щ е е с я тем, что, с целью расширения функциональных возможностей устройства за счет формирования суммарного кода рассогласования для каждой линии сканирования, в него введены буферный регистр, блок управления сумматором и выходной регистр, первый вход которого соединен с четвертым .выходом блока управления, второй вход с первым выходом блока управления сумматором, третий вход — с выходом реверсивного счетчика и первым входом блока .управления сумматором, чет-.вертый вход — с первым выходом буферного регистра и вторым входом сумматора, второй выход входного регистра подключен ко второму входу блока управления сумматором, третий вход. которого соединен с пятым выходом блока управления, четвертый вход " со вторым выходом буферного регистра, первый вход которого подключен к первому выходу сумматора, второй вход — к шестому выходу блока упраВления, второй вход реверсивнorо счетчика соединен со вторым выходом блока управления сумматором, выход выходного регистра является вторым выходом устройства.

Источники информации, принятые во внимание при экспертизе

1. Peter Bounds. Buffering High

Speed Data for minicomputing "input. Computer Design.. Р 7, V, 12> 1973, р. 69.

2. Овчинников В.И. Устройство автоматического обмена информацией, И., Энергия, 1971, с. 141 (про тотип) . г с

° ° ° I

696437

Составитель С. Громова

Редактор С. Равва Техред М. Келемеш Корректор Г. Решетник

Заказ 6767/48 Тираж 780 Подписное

БИИИПИ Государственного комитета СССР по делам изобретений и открытий

113035, Москва, Ж-35, Раушская наб., д. 4/5

Филиал ППП Патент, г ° Ужгород, ул . Проектная, 4

Устройство для ввода информации в вычислительную машину Устройство для ввода информации в вычислительную машину Устройство для ввода информации в вычислительную машину Устройство для ввода информации в вычислительную машину 

 

Похожие патенты:

Изобретение относится к измерительной технике и предназначено для определения плотности жидкости

Изобретение относится к устройствам телевизоров, имеющих формат изображения широкоэкранного соотношения сторон

Изобретение относится к различным вариантам схем автоматического переключения входного сигнала монитора

Изобретение относится к области компьютерной техники, преимущественно к ручному вводу данных в компьютер

Изобретение относится к области вычислительной техники, в частности к конструкции клавиатур для ввода информации

Изобретение относится к устройствам многоцелевых оптических клавиатур, представляющим широкое разнообразие вводов клавиш

Изобретение относится к осуществлению виртуальной реальности или телереальности

Изобретение относится к устройству и способу управления работой канала данных отображения (ДДС) монитора

Изобретение относится к устройствам ввода, таким, как клавиатура, и может быть использовано для пишущей машинки, компьютера и других аналогичных устройств

Изобретение относится к вычислительной технике и может быть использовано в информационно-управляющих автоматизированных системах
Наверх